The data center buildout represents the most significant load growth event for the American grid in decades, with projections showing dozens of gigawatts of new demand concentrated in specific utility territories. Unlike traditional industrial loads, these facilities demand 24/7 power with extreme reliability requirements, forcing utilities to accelerate generation and transmission investments that would normally unfold over decades. The legal frameworks governing cost recovery, resource adequacy, and interconnection were not designed for this pace or concentration of demand.

Central to the debate are questions of cost allocation: whether existing ratepayers should subsidize infrastructure built primarily for new commercial loads, how to structure tariffs that reflect the unique operational profiles of data centers, and whether state regulators have adequate authority to condition approvals on grid benefits. Federal Energy Regulatory Commission proceedings on capacity markets and transmission planning are simultaneously reshaping the rules, creating a layered regulatory environment where precedent is being set in real time.

Decisions made in the next two to three years — on integrated resource plans, certificate of need proceedings, and rate cases — will lock in cost structures and reliability outcomes for a generation. Understanding the legal boundaries of utility obligations and regulatory discretion is no longer academic; it is a prerequisite for viable project development and sound policy.
